

Maria Esperança
Maria Esperança is a Brazilian telenovela produced by SBT and originally broadcast from March 26 to August 7, 2007. It is a Brazilian adaptation of the Mexican telenovela María Mercedes (1992), created by Valentín Pimstein and based on the original story Enamorada by Inés Rodena. Adapted by Yves Dumont, with text supervision by Henrique Zambelli and Thereza di Giácomo, the telenovela stars Bárbara Paz and Ricardo Ramory. The story follows Maria, a humble young woman who sells flowers on the streets to support her family. Her life changes when she meets Eduardo, a wealthy man who marries her to protect his inheritance and challenge his greedy relatives. After his death, Maria becomes the heir to his fortune and faces the hostility of those who want to take everything from her. Amid secrets, betrayals, and family conflicts, she discovers love and learns to fight for her happiness.
